Leicester City star a “doubt” for Newcastle game on Sunday – BBC Sport

James Maddison is a ‘doubt’ for our trip to the Leicester on Sunday according to BBC Sport.

Given how influential the England international has been over Leicester City’s opening 6 games of the season, this could be a real boost to our hopes ahead of what promises to be a tough away day this weekend.

Not only did Maddison score the winner and shine in the Foxes 2-1 victory over Spurs last time out – a result that’s lifted them to 3rd – the stats say that no other player has created more chances in the Premier League (109) than him since the start of last season.

He makes them tick and has outstanding vision, technical ability and set piece delivery, with him also scoring in our Carabao Cup clash with Leicester just a few weeks ago.

Leicester’s assistant Chris Davies claims he’ll be assessed in the coming days to see if he can feature, however it sounds like he’s unlikely to start after limping off against Spurs last Saturday.

Regarding all things NUFC, it’s not yet known if Saint-Maximin will be fit to start, but Sean Longstaff is expected to return after recovering from an ankle injury.
